European buyers should give factories enough information to assess whether the product, material, test and documentation requirements can be met for the specific programme.

Include product construction, composition, finishes, colour standards, packaging, estimated quantities, destination country and any buyer-specific compliance expectations.
Keep a record of supplier replies, factory documents, testing, approvals and changes. Requirements vary by product and market, so use qualified legal and compliance advice where needed.
